nedoPC.org

Electronics hobbyists community established in 2002
Atom Feed | View unanswered posts | View active topics It is currently 28 Mar 2024 16:49



Reply to topic  [ 211 posts ]  Go to page Previous  1 ... 6, 7, 8, 9, 10, 11, 12 ... 15  Next
IBM PCjr 
Author Message
Admin
User avatar

Joined: 08 Jan 2003 23:22
Posts: 22412
Location: Silicon Valley
Reply with quote
IgorR76 wrote:
И всё таки если подсоединить дисковод от PCjr к ноуту с Freedos? В интерфейс внешнего 3.5'? Ведь все проблемы решатся, и нужный софт окажется на дискетах?

Там дисковод внешний - через спец-разъём тошибовский подключен - там никакой другой не подцепить

_________________
:dj: https://mastodon.social/@Shaos


31 Dec 2016 19:10
Profile WWW
Admin
User avatar

Joined: 08 Jan 2003 23:22
Posts: 22412
Location: Silicon Valley
Reply with quote
Shaos wrote:
Shaos wrote:
(и похоже только в его начале должна располагаться сигнатура, по которому биос будет распознавать наличие картриджа - 055h, 0AAh, Length/512, ...)

В том же документе есть кое-какие исходники биоса :o

https://archive.org/details/bitsavers_ibmpcpcjrPceNov83_24513363

Купил этот толмудик в бумажном виде на eBay за тридцатку с небольшим - он НОВЫЙ (в смысле в сопле ниразу не распечатанный с 1983 года)! Там еще и принципиальные схемы имеются :o
Интересно что там листы вставлены в папку-скоросшиватель с тремя планками - стопка бумаг тоже в сопле и отдельно "update" в виде небольшой пачки страниц с инструкцией вместо каких листов вставить заменяющие и новые листы :)


Attachments:
PCjr-tech.jpg
PCjr-tech.jpg [ 164.33 KiB | Viewed 20650 times ]

_________________
:dj: https://mastodon.social/@Shaos
02 Jan 2017 13:17
Profile WWW
Supreme God
User avatar

Joined: 21 Oct 2009 08:08
Posts: 7777
Location: Россия
Reply with quote
Shaos wrote:
Шнур уже пришёл (см. фотку), ...
Ну а чего не попробуешь перегнать файл через шнур? Вроде как всё уже есть...
Мне думается, надо стартануть ДОС с твоей дискетки. ВАСИК после этого сможет работать с файлами,
и надо попробовать загнать пробный файлик на диск через ВАСИК...

_________________
iLavr


09 Jan 2017 15:01
Profile
Admin
User avatar

Joined: 08 Jan 2003 23:22
Posts: 22412
Location: Silicon Valley
Reply with quote
Lavr wrote:
Shaos wrote:
Шнур уже пришёл (см. фотку), ...
Ну а чего не попробуешь перегнать файл через шнур? Вроде как всё уже есть...
Мне думается, надо стартануть ДОС с твоей дискетки. ВАСИК после этого сможет работать с файлами,
и надо попробовать загнать пробный файлик на диск через ВАСИК...

Переходника нету из 25 ног в 9 :)

Еще вот сегодня пришел новодел JR-IDE (сто басков за него отдал автору) - это не только IDE, но и расширение памяти по максимуму (+1 мег) и батарейные часики:

https://www.retrotronics.org/home-page/jride/


Attachments:
JR-IDE.jpg
JR-IDE.jpg [ 70.16 KiB | Viewed 20608 times ]

_________________
:dj: https://mastodon.social/@Shaos
09 Jan 2017 16:09
Profile WWW
Admin
User avatar

Joined: 08 Jan 2003 23:22
Posts: 22412
Location: Silicon Valley
Reply with quote
Попробую к нему подцепить вот этот переходничок на компакт-флеш купленный еще в 2007:

Image

И питание будет не отдельным шнуром, а c 20-й ноги (JR-IDE это тоже поддерживает)

P.S. Также таки купил PC-DOS 2.10 коробочку-дистрибутив (говорят в сопле) - с доставкой получилось $71 - ждемс...

P.P.S. Вот тут интересно про хитрости, чтобы дос работал быстрее (грузясь в быструю память начиная от 128КБ т.к. все что ниже тормозит потому что видео):
http://www.brutman.com/forums/viewtopic.php?f=6&t=592

_________________
:dj: https://mastodon.social/@Shaos


09 Jan 2017 16:10
Profile WWW
Admin
User avatar

Joined: 08 Jan 2003 23:22
Posts: 22412
Location: Silicon Valley
Reply with quote
Пришли мои клоны картриджа на 64К :)


Attachments:
PCjrCart-1-small.jpg
PCjrCart-1-small.jpg [ 95.85 KiB | Viewed 20592 times ]

_________________
:dj: https://mastodon.social/@Shaos
10 Jan 2017 16:44
Profile WWW
Admin
User avatar

Joined: 08 Jan 2003 23:22
Posts: 22412
Location: Silicon Valley
Reply with quote
Собрал:

Attachment:
PCjrCart0.jpg
PCjrCart0.jpg [ 97.37 KiB | Viewed 20587 times ]


Воткнул EEPROM:

Attachment:
PCjrCart1.jpg
PCjrCart1.jpg [ 97.76 KiB | Viewed 20587 times ]


Работает :)

_________________
:dj: https://mastodon.social/@Shaos


10 Jan 2017 19:42
Profile WWW
Admin
User avatar

Joined: 08 Jan 2003 23:22
Posts: 22412
Location: Silicon Valley
Reply with quote
Подправил программку (16-битный борланд глючит если размер выделенной памяти подбирается к 64КБ) и прошил VC.COM в картридж :)

Attachment:
PCjrCart2.jpg
PCjrCart2.jpg [ 79 KiB | Viewed 20578 times ]


Контрольная сумма посчиталась верно, Волков запустился, но ругнулся:

Attachment:
PCjr-cart-vc.jpg
PCjr-cart-vc.jpg [ 49.59 KiB | Viewed 20578 times ]


Так что Волков тут работать небудет, пока я не пересяду с PC-DOS 2.10 на что-то более новое...

P.S. Покопался в архивах - у меня есть DiskDupe-образы загрузочных дискет MS-DOS 3.3, MS-DOS 5 и MS-DOS 6.22 (последние 2 на PCjr точно работать небудут, а вот 3.3 можно будет попробовать)

_________________
:dj: https://mastodon.social/@Shaos


11 Jan 2017 05:50
Profile WWW
Senior

Joined: 31 Mar 2012 16:50
Posts: 152
Location: 93.73.80.128
Reply with quote
Shaos wrote:
...грузясь в быструю память начиная от 128 МБ т.к. все что ниже тормозит потому что видео)...


Эх мысли навеяло:

Mда опечатка по Фрейду - "128 МБ"! Мир стал 64bit-ным и давлеет над нами, потому то жаба еще долго не умрет а будет жить в android-е еще долго долго (может в слегка другой форме).

Просматривается сходство с ПОИСК-1 и даже синклером: есть графическая память с отдельной шиной данных, но не вся она отдана видеоконтроллеру, и прога в ней тормозит. Причем в ПОИСК-1 со встроенными ру7 тормозят первые 512кб установленных на плате а с РУ5 первые 128кб как и в jr.

Хотя с другой стороны, по идее, если у обычного пэцэ код расположить в памяти видеоадаптера то будет или тормозить или "снег" на экране. В какойто мере тоже самое, значит сходство глобальное. Даже в системах где графическая память НЕ мапится на шину проца (по типу NES) всеравно либо проц либо DMA будут тормозится видеопроцом или будет ити "снег" на экране.

Выход - двухпортовая память или память вдвое быстрее чем проц. Вот тут может так оно и работает с этим мегабайтом в ide контроллере на статике?


11 Jan 2017 11:24
Profile
Admin
User avatar

Joined: 08 Jan 2003 23:22
Posts: 22412
Location: Silicon Valley
Reply with quote
Да блин который раз уже вместо КБ пишу МБ :)

Я так понял, что всё что выше 128КБ ;) не тормозится в-принципе т.к. по другой шине идёт (наружу)

_________________
:dj: https://mastodon.social/@Shaos


11 Jan 2017 11:29
Profile WWW
Admin
User avatar

Joined: 08 Jan 2003 23:22
Posts: 22412
Location: Silicon Valley
Reply with quote
Shaos wrote:
Заодно прочитал содержимое выпаянных микросхем - при жизни это был картридж IBM PCjr ColorPaint, который у меня так и не запустился...

Записал прочитанное в свой картридж и сумел таки его запустить :)

Attachment:
PCjr-ColorPaint.jpg
PCjr-ColorPaint.jpg [ 91.35 KiB | Viewed 20557 times ]


Суть в том, что этот картридж требует наличия доса, даже хотя бы с бутабельного диска - далее в командной строке доса набирается G и Enter (картридж при инициализации сообщает биосу, что умеет обрабатывать команду G) - оно таки запускается, но без мыши бесполезно...

_________________
:dj: https://mastodon.social/@Shaos


11 Jan 2017 22:02
Profile WWW
Doomed

Joined: 16 Dec 2014 11:58
Posts: 370
Location: Киев
Reply with quote
Shaos wrote:
командной строке доса набирается G и Enter (катридж при инициализации сообщает биосу, что умеет обрабатывать команду G)

Тому, кто это придумал, надо в голову гвоздь забить (с) ДМБ.
:-?


12 Jan 2017 01:46
Profile
Supreme God
User avatar

Joined: 21 Oct 2009 08:08
Posts: 7777
Location: Россия
Reply with quote
Shaos wrote:
IBM PCjr ColorPaint, ... - оно таки запускается, но без мыши бесполезно...
О, блин... как я мучался с этим всем на "Искре-1030"... :-?
Большинство графредакторов хотят мышь - а у меня её не было... Так что я сначала рисовал кнопками курсора на "Специалисте" и перекидывал картинки в "Искру-1030"... :mrgreen:
Но потом нашел-таки графредактор, который понимает клавиши курсора, а еще позже - драйвер, который конвертирует нажатие клавиш курсора в команды мыши... :wink:

Только это было уже не актуально. У меня уже была своя личная 286-я машина с EGA и мышью.
И интернета ведь не было... по друзьям-знакомым софт искали.

_________________
iLavr


12 Jan 2017 07:47
Profile
Admin
User avatar

Joined: 08 Jan 2003 23:22
Posts: 22412
Location: Silicon Valley
Reply with quote
Lavr wrote:
Shaos wrote:
IBM PCjr ColorPaint, ... - оно таки запускается, но без мыши бесполезно...
О, блин... как я мучался с этим всем на "Искре-1030"... :-?
Большинство графредакторов хотят мышь - а у меня её не было... Так что я сначала рисовал кнопками курсора на "Специалисте" и перекидывал картинки в "Искру-1030"... :mrgreen:
Но потом нашел-таки графредактор, который понимает клавиши курсора, а еще позже - драйвер, который конвертирует нажатие клавиш курсора в команды мыши... :wink:

Только это было уже не актуально. У меня уже была своя личная 286-я машина с EGA и мышью.
И интернета ведь не было... по друзьям-знакомым софт искали.

А у нас в первой половине 90х в общаге диски друг у друга копировали - такой общажный "интранет" был :)

_________________
:dj: https://mastodon.social/@Shaos


12 Jan 2017 08:23
Profile WWW
Admin
User avatar

Joined: 08 Jan 2003 23:22
Posts: 22412
Location: Silicon Valley
Reply with quote
Vic3Dexe wrote:
Shaos wrote:
командной строке доса набирается G и Enter (катридж при инициализации сообщает биосу, что умеет обрабатывать команду G)

Тому, кто это придумал, надо в голову гвоздь забить (с) ДМБ.
:-?

Угу - если бы я с его дампом не начал разбираться, сверяя заголовок с PCjr Technical Reference, то так бы и продолжал думать, что этот картридж нерабочий :)

_________________
:dj: https://mastodon.social/@Shaos


12 Jan 2017 08:24
Profile WWW
Display posts from previous:  Sort by  
Reply to topic   [ 211 posts ]  Go to page Previous  1 ... 6, 7, 8, 9, 10, 11, 12 ... 15  Next

Who is online

Users browsing this forum: No registered users and 6 guests


You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ot post attachments in this forum

Search for:
Jump to:  
Powered by phpBB® Forum Software © phpBB Group
Designed by ST Software.